In the world of residential assisted living, your reputation is your most valuable asset. It precedes you in every interaction, determining whether you attract high quality staff and residents or struggle to keep your beds full.
In this episode, Isabelle Guarino from the Assisted Living Network explains why your reputation can either bring you clients with ease or deter seniors and staff from your home entirely. With 76 million baby boomers looking for housing solutions, the opportunity is massive, but only for those who maintain a high standard of care and professionalism.
We dive deep into the three essential pillars of reputation. First, we discuss your staffing reputation and how treating caregivers with respect prevents drama and high turnover. Next, we cover how to go above and beyond for seniors and their families through creative gestures that get people talking. Finally, we explore the importance of your standing with industry professionals like placement agents and hospice agencies who act as the gatekeepers for your business.
Whether you are looking to buy an existing care home or starting your own from the ground up, these insights will help you fill your beds and stay in business for the long run.
